Output 1fde3a20f63235d283465311f52c66ecca07049309828653e557c1852e19fb07:5

value
2610579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 285b6c6eff3b0096317152a6d8baae8c58942551 OP_EQUALVERIFY OP_CHECKSIG
address
14gPYtrrby9yMuoKy2U8EauGsyihmejqyk
transaction
1fde3a20f63235d283465311f52c66ecca07049309828653e557c1852e19fb07
spent
true